Overview
- Head coach Shane Steichen said DeForest Buckner is expected to be activated from injured reserve and play Monday after consecutive full practices.
- Indianapolis ruled out cornerback Sauce Gardner (calf) and wide receiver Anthony Gould (foot), and Steichen said he expects Gardner to play again this season.
- Buckner has been sidelined since Week 9 with a herniated disk pressing on a nerve and chose stem‑cell treatment in Panama instead of surgery.
- The Colts opened 21‑day practice windows for quarterback Anthony Richardson (eye) and safety Daniel Scott (knee); Richardson practiced on a limited basis and will not be available Monday.
- San Francisco ruled out wide receiver Ricky Pearsall (knee/ankle) and cornerback Renardo Green (neck), with Pearsall not traveling as he continues rehabilitation.
